I am a clinical psychologist and psychotherapist, working with adults and couples who are experiencing difficulties such as anxiety, depression, trauma, eating disorders, relational challenges, and other forms of emotional distress.
Therapy offers a safe space to better understand your inner world — what you feel, think, and experience — and how this shapes your life and relationships.
I believe each person is the expert of their own life story. Therapy is grounded in this respect, adapting to each person’s pace, context, and needs.
Throughout the process, it becomes possible to develop greater awareness of internal patterns and to create space for a more integrated relationship with oneself. This can facilitate access to internal states associated with calm, clarity, confidence, and compassion, allowing you to relate to experiences of pain, fear, shame, or emotional blockage in a safer and more conscious way.
